The book offers a personal exploration of the author's journey to faith, emphasizing that Christianity addresses fundamental human needs. Chesterton presents a unique perspective, portraying the Christian religion as a solution to life's complexities rather than a mere external truth. His reflections aim to illuminate how belief can emerge from within one's own experiences, framing faith as an integral part of human understanding.
